After Chickenpox and treatment with Penvir 500, a feeling of heaviness and mild stomach spasms can occur due to temporary digestive upset or a side effect of the medicine. Eat light, easily digestible food, avoid oily/spicy items, and drink plenty of water; you can use a probiotic or a mild antispasmodic if needed. Since there is no pain or constipation, it is usually not serious, but if the heaviness persists beyond a week, worsens, or you develop vomiting or fever, consult a doctor for evaluation.
